Klinaklini Hydroelectric Project
Projects that were undergoing a comprehensive study at the time the provisions of the Canadian Environmental Assessment Act, 2012 came into force will continue to follow the requirements of the former Act. Under the former Act, the Canadian Environmental Assessment Agency is responsible for conducting the comprehensive study of this project.
Kleana Power Corporation proposes to develop a run-of-river hydroelectric power project on the Klinaklini River on the mainland coast of British Columbia, 167 km northeast of Campbell River, B.C. The proposed development would have an average power output of 280 MW, with the capacity to produce 700 MW at maximum river flows. The project consists of: a diversion weir intake, headpond, penstock/18 km tunnel, powerhouse, tailrace, waste rock disposal, upgrades to existing logging roads, construction of new roads where required, upgrades of existing barge landing facility, and an aerial transmission line across Johnstone Strait and along Vancouver Island to Campbell River.
